STROUDSBURG, Pa. -- The East Stroudsburg University softball team split a midweek doubleheader against the Kutztown Golden Bears on Tuesday, winning the first game 1-0 before falling in game two 6-4 despite a late rally.
The Warriors are now 14-10 overall and 2-4 in conference action.
Game 1
On the mound was Sarah Davenport who improved to 8-4 on the season after she limited the Golden Bears to just two hits and no runs, while striking out nine.
At the plate, Kinsley Proepper and Megan Chroniger each recorded two hits, while Tulana Mingin and Katie Master added one apiece. Chroniger scored the game's only run.
The decisive moment came in the fourth inning when Chroniger tripled to right field and later crossed the plate on a throwing error.
Game 2
Proepper and Kaitlynn Colangelo each recorded two hits while four players recorded one hit each.
In the second game, Kutztown got out to an early 2-0 lead before the Warriors got on the board in the bottom of the second. The Golden Bears then scored a run in each of the fourth, fifth, and sixth innings to take a 6-1 advantage. In the bottom of the sixth the Warriors responded scoring three runs on four hits, 6-4.
The Golden Bears scored two runs on one hit and two errors in the second. Proepper opened the bottom of the inning with a triple down the right field line then later scored on Chroniger's sacrifice fly to left field.
Through three innings, Kutztown added four runs on seven hits to push ESU's deficit to five, 6-1.
The Warriors rallied in the bottom of the sixth, scoring three runs on four hits. With two outs, Delaney Ridgell singled to right field, stole second, then scored on Proepper's RBI single to right field. Addison Bianco came in to pinch run for Proepper and then stole second. Bianco scored on Chroniger's RBI triple to left field. Chroniger then scored the Warrior's final run on Master's RBI single up the middle.
In the seventh with two outs, Mingin singled through the left side but was left on base with a final groundout.
